HVAC temperature sensor. There is a little motor encased behind that pillar to draw air in. It could be failing.
 
Oh I see! Thats most likely the case then. Guess I'll start with removing it and have a look. Thanks.
 
That is known as the Aspirator and that buzzing is a common problem. Replacing it will take care of the noise.
 
Actually, it probably has dust around the fan (and the thermistor), clean it and a tiny (very tiny) drop of light oil will free it.
 
If that is the "clean" pic, it was dirty. Try a little compressed air, if you don't have access to a compressor, you can buy hand held cans, of compressed air, in computer stores. Canadian Staples, US Office Depot, sell them for between $5 and $10.
